12 Facts About Neil Larsen

1.

Neil Larsen was born on August 7,1948 and is an American jazz keyboardist, musical arranger and composer.

2.

Neil Larsen was born in Cleveland, Ohio and grew up in Sarasota, Florida before relocating to New York and then, in 1977, Los Angeles.

3.

Neil Larsen learned piano, drawing inspiration from jazz artists John Coltrane, Miles Davis and the Modern Jazz Quartet, and from contemporary rock acts.

4.

Neil Larsen formed the band Full Moon with jazz guitarist Buzz Feiten, and their self-titled debut album was released in 1972.

5.

Neil Larsen contributed as keyboardist, writer and arranger on their 1974 self-titled album on the TSOP label.

6.

Neil Larsen began touring as a member of Gregg Allman's band in 1975.

7.

In 1977, Neil Larsen relocated to Los Angeles, where he played on sessions by producers such as Tommy LiPuma, Russ Titelman and Herb Alpert.

9.

Neil Larsen has recorded and toured with guitarist Robben Ford, who contributed to Larsen's 2007 album Orbit.

10.

Neil Larsen's compositions have been recorded by George Benson and Gregg Allman, among others.

11.

Neil Larsen has worked as a session musician for many rock artists, including Rickie Lee Jones, George Harrison, Kenny Loggins and Don McLean.

12.

Neil Larsen was the pianist and musical arranger for the 20th Century Fox Television show Boston Legal, and musical director for jazz singer Al Jarreau.
